Different Sorts Of Piping Products
Piping materials are a necessary element in pipes systems, affecting sturdiness, performance, and total performance. Various alternatives are offered, each with distinct homes and applications. Copper piping is understood for its durability and resistance to corrosion, making it a prominent option for both cool and hot water lines. PVC (polyvinyl chloride) is light-weight, cost-effective, and resistant to chemical damage, largely made use of for drain and air vent systems. PEX (cross-linked polyethylene) has gained appeal due to its versatility and convenience of installation, permitting less joints and possible leakage points. Galvanized steel, though once typical, is much less favorable today due to its vulnerability to corrosion and minimized water circulation in time. Each material provides distinctive advantages and drawbacks, making it essential for homeowners to seek advice from pipes experts to identify one of the most ideal alternative for their particular demands and problems. Choosing Substitute Materials
After evaluating the existing pipes, house owners encounter the vital decision of choosing appropriate replacement products for their pipes system. Common alternatives include copper, PVC, PEX, and CPVC, each with unique benefits and disadvantages. Copper is known for its durability and resistance to air duct hose corrosion, making it a long-lasting option. PVC is cost-effective and light-weight, ideal for drain and vent lines. PEX uses versatility and is resistant to scale and chlorine, making installation simpler in tight spaces. CPVC is similar to PVC yet can endure higher temperatures. Home owners must consider elements such as spending plan, neighborhood building regulations, and the particular demands of their plumbing system when making this choice, making sure excellent efficiency and longevity for their home's pipes framework.
Installation Refine Summary
Repiping a home can be a substantial endeavor, but understanding the installation process assists home owners plan for what lies in advance. The process typically begins click over here with an extensive inspection of the existing pipes system to recognize trouble locations. Next, a comprehensive plan is developed, describing the required products and timelines. On the installment day, experts will commonly start by shutting off the water and draining the existing pipelines. They after that eliminate the old piping, which may involve opening up walls or ceilings for access. Brand-new pipelines are mounted, guaranteeing they satisfy present pipes codes. The system is evaluated for leaks, and any type of openings are repaired. Property owners can anticipate a clean and reliable procedure, lessening disruption to their everyday lives.

The length of time Does a Common Repiping Job Take to Total?
A common repiping task usually takes between one to five days to finish, depending on the dimension of the home and intricacy of the pipes system. Appropriate planning and service provider proficiency can influence general duration substantially.

What Is the Ordinary Price of Repiping a Home?
The ordinary expense of repiping a home generally varies from $4,000 to $15,000, depending on variables such as the dimension of the home, materials utilized, and labor expenses related to the pipes work. - Houston Repipe Company
